At the 5:00 minute mark of the video: The red 2-door hardtop is a 1966 Ford Galaxie 500. The warranty plate decodes as follows: The vehicle model is the Galaxie 500 2-door hardtop (base price $2684.74, 198,532 produced). It was Ford number 69380 built at the Los Angeles, California assembly plant during the 1966 model year (first VIN was 100001). As built, the engine was a 390-4V Thunderbird Special V-8 (315 hp@4600 rpm, 427 ft-lbs@2800 rpm, 10.5:1 compression ratio), backed by the C6 Cruise-O-Matic 3-speed automatic transmission with column shift, and driving through a 3.00:1 non-locking differential. It was finished with the Candyapple Red exterior color, and the interior trim was bench seat with red "Venetian" pattern vinyl cushions and red "Crinkle" pattern vinyl bolsters and back. It had a scheduled build date of May 12, 1966, and the order was processed through the Denver, Colorado district sales office, which covered Colorado, western Nebraska and eastern Wyoming.
